See, that's what shopping for stuff in sales should be about. You have a need of something, so you look for that thing in an upcoming sale, saving money on the purchase and generally getting a warm cuddly feeling for doing it. Buying something you didn't want, have no need for or something that's been advertised and you now want because it's cheap isn't a bargain, it's an expense you didn't need to make.
I read somewhere that the hardest thing to convince people of is that a bargain costs money.
